Bulk Purchase Selection Guide

Procurement professionals evaluating pure peptide labs must navigate common pitfalls that compromise research integrity. The most frequent error involves accepting purity claims without requesting raw chromatographic data, as some suppliers report area percent without correcting for UV absorption coefficients. Another critical oversight involves neglecting to verify peptide content versus peptide purity, where salt content from counterions can reduce actual peptide mass by 15-25%.

Selection standards should include requesting the actual HPLC trace with retention time windows, confirming that the mass spectrum shows the correct molecular ion without adducts, and verifying that the amino acid analysis matches theoretical composition within 10% tolerance. Buyers should also request stability data under accelerated conditions (40°C/75% RH for 4 weeks) to assess formulation compatibility.

A comprehensive buyer checklist includes: (1) Certificate of Analysis with raw data attachments, (2) Material Safety Data Sheet (MSDS) in current format, (3) allergen statement confirming absence of common allergens, (4) residual solvent report per USP <467>, and (5) heavy metal analysis per ICH Q3D. Q: How do I verify the purity of received peptide batches?
A: Request the original HPLC chromatogram with integration parameters, and compare the main peak area to total peak area. For critical applications, consider sending samples to an independent laboratory for confirmatory analysis using reversed-phase HPLC with UV detection at 214 nm.

Q: Can pure peptide labs provide peptides with specific counterion exchange?
A: Yes, many suppliers offer TFA-to-acetate or TFA-to-HCl exchange services. This process uses ion-exchange chromatography to replace trifluoroacetic acid counterions with biologically compatible alternatives, which is essential for cell-based assays and in vivo studies.

Production Process and Purification

Manufacturing begins with automated SPPS using Fmoc chemistry on specialized resin supports. The synthesis cycle includes sequential amino acid coupling, deprotection, and washing steps controlled by computer-monitored systems. Following synthesis, crude peptides undergo preparative HPLC purification using C18 reverse-phase columns with gradient elution systems. This process achieves the target purity levels while removing truncated sequences and deletion impurities that commonly affect lower-grade products.

Q2: How do I verify the purity claims made by peptide suppliers before placing bulk orders?
A2: Request representative samples from multiple production batches and conduct independent HPLC analysis in your laboratory or through a third-party testing service. Compare the results with the supplier's CoA to verify accuracy. Additionally, request batch-specific stability data and confirm that the supplier uses validated analytical methods with documented system suitability criteria. Establishing a qualification protocol with defined acceptance criteria before bulk purchasing protects against quality discrepancies.
